[0.16.38] Direction-dependant inserter inconsistency

Posted: Sun Apr 29, 2018 7:01 pm
by Teraka
Bug in action
Inserters are inserting their items off to one side, which doesn't matter when using belts but does dramatically change their inserting rate onto splitters.
You can see north/south inserters inserting onto the west side, and east/west inserters inserting onto the north side, regardless of splitter direction.
Interestingly, this doesn't seem to happen on belts, on which items are inserted relative to belt direction.

Re: Direction-dependant inserter inconsistency

Posted: Mon Apr 30, 2018 10:05 am
by kovarex
Ok, so I actually had to admit, that there was an inconsistency.
You can see it in the video actually, that in one side, the item is actually placed on the edge of the tile, instead of the middle. It is fixed for the next version now.
